Terrace Hill Developments - Offices Development - Bristol, Temple Circus
Date: 11 Jul 2003
Terrace Hill Developments has achieved detailed planning consent for its Temple Circus office development in Bristol city centre.
The 8,453 sq m (91,000 sq ft) scheme will consist of seven storeys of air conditioned offices with 56 parking spaces. Construction is due to start during the first quarter of 2004 with completion scheduled for September 2005.
The development is located opposite Temple Quay which is home to Bristol & West, DETR, BT, Regus, Osborne Clarke, Canada Life, Offsted and 3i.
Adam Pratt, a director of Terrace Hill comments: “Discussions are already taking place with a number of possible tenants which confirms the shortage of grade A offices in the city centre.”
Temple Circus is Terrace Hill’s third development in Bristol which follows South Bristol Trade Park and Colston 33 and is being carried out in association with Bristol City Council.
ATIS REAL Weatheralls and Alder King are joint letting agents.
